ALEXANDRIA, Va., March 26 -- United States Patent no. 12,257,238, issued on March 25, was assigned to Nutrition21 LLC (Saddle Brook, N.J.).
"Magnesium biotinate compositions and methods of use" was invented by Deanna J. Nelson (Raleigh, N.C.) and James R. Komorowski (Trumbull, Conn.).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"The present application relates to magnesium biotinate compositions and methods of use. The methods and compositions disclosed herein are particularly useful for providing bioavailable biotin to mammals and treating or preventing symptoms of biotin deficiency."
The patent was filed on Feb. 14, 2024, under Application No. 18/441,413.
